WBC ORDERS LINARES-PRIETO FOR 135 LB. TITLE; FIGUEROA NAMED CHAMPION IN RECESS The WBC have announced that former Two-Division World Champion Jorge Linares (37-3, 24KOs) will fight WBC Silver Lightweight Champion Javier Prieto (24-7-2, 18KOs) for the vacant WBC Lightweight World Championship; & say the fight will take place before the end of the year 2014. WBC Lightweight World Champion Omar Figueroa (24-0-1, 18KOs) has been named as the WBC Champion In Recess while he recovers from a terrible eye injury sustained in his August 16 9th round KO win over mandatory challenger Daniel Estrada. The WBC said that the winner of Linares-Prieto would to defend the WBC 135 lb. Championship against Figueroa whenever Omar was ready & able to return to the ring; if he chooses to remain at 135 lb. when he returns. The WBC Board of Governors has voted unanimously to support Omar Figueroa while he is recovering from an injury sustained in his mandatory title defense of August 16 vs. Daniel Estrada WBC President Mauricio Sulaiman announced in a statement. After the fight, his cut was infected and had to receive additional treatment. He has been placed as Champion in Recess, which will allow him to take the necessary time to heal and to begin training without any time pressure. The WBC has ordered the two highest available contenders to fight for the WBC lightweight championship, with the condition that the winner must fight Figueroa whenever he is ready to return to the ring. Jorge Linares vs. Javier Prieto has been ordered and is expected to be promoted within 2014.
